Why Firmware Updates Matter for Your LG 32GS95UE
Firmware updates enhance your monitor’s functionality, fix bugs, and improve compatibility with other devices. For the LG 32GS95UE, updates can introduce new features such as improved color accuracy, better refresh rate stability, and enhanced gaming modes. Keeping your firmware current ensures you get the best possible experience from your device.
Benefits of Regular Firmware Updates
- Improved Performance: Updates can optimize display performance and reduce issues like flickering or lag.
- Enhanced Compatibility: Ensures your monitor works seamlessly with the latest graphics cards and software.
- Security: Fixes vulnerabilities that could be exploited by malicious software.
- New Features: Access to new functionalities introduced by LG through firmware releases.
How to Check Your Current Firmware Version
Before updating, verify your current firmware version. You can do this through the monitor’s on-screen display (OSD) menu or via the LG software on your connected PC. Typically, the firmware version is found in the settings or information section of the OSD menu.
Checking via On-Screen Display
Navigate to the settings menu on your monitor using the physical buttons. Look for an “Information” or “About” section where the firmware version is displayed.
Checking via LG Software
If you have LG’s software installed on your PC, open it and locate your monitor in the device list. The software typically displays firmware details there.
How to Update the Firmware on Your LG 32GS95UE
Updating firmware involves downloading the latest version from LG’s official website and following the provided instructions. Here’s a general guide:
Step 1: Visit the LG Support Website
Go to LG’s official support page and search for your monitor model, LG 32GS95UE. Locate the firmware download section.
Step 2: Download the Firmware File
Download the latest firmware update file to your computer. Ensure that the file is compatible with your monitor model.
Step 3: Prepare a USB Drive
Format a USB flash drive to FAT32 format. Copy the downloaded firmware file onto the drive.
Step 4: Connect and Update
Disconnect your monitor from power. Insert the USB drive into the monitor’s USB port. Turn on the monitor and follow the on-screen prompts to initiate the firmware update process. Do not turn off or disconnect the monitor during this process.
Precautions and Tips
- Backup Settings: Save your custom settings before updating.
- Stable Power Supply: Ensure the monitor is connected to a reliable power source.
- Follow Instructions: Carefully follow the update instructions provided by LG.
- Do Not Interrupt: Avoid turning off the monitor during the update process.
